After flying high against Moon Valley last Thursday, Thunderbird came back down to earth. Thunderbird fell just short of the Marcos de Niza Padres by a score of 7-6 on Saturday. The Titans were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Padres apparently hadn't forgotten their defeat the last time these teams played back in March of 2022.

John Paul (JP) Stewart made the most of his time at bat despite the final result and scored a run while going 2-for-3. That's the most hits he has posted since March 6th. The team also got some help courtesy of Joshua Gulinson, who scored a run and stole a base while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ances.
Thunderbird's record is now 9-7. As for Marcos de Niza, their record now sits at 6-8.
Looking ahead, Thunderbird will square off against Goldwater at 3:45 p.m. on Monday. Goldwater has struggled to contain batters this season (they've allowed nine runs per game on average), something Thunderbird will no doubt try to take advantage of. As for Marcos de Niza, they will take on Mesquite at 3:45 p.m. on Monday. Marcos de Niza's pitchers better be ready for this one: Mesquite has averaged an impressive 9.5 runs per game this season.
